Zheng Gu Shui (正骨水)

Traditional Chinese Traumatology Liniment

Zheng Gu Shui is a classic topical herbal liniment used in Chinese medicine to support the healing of injuries involving muscles, tendons, and bones. Traditionally used by martial artists and trauma practitioners, this penetrating formula helps invigorate blood circulation, reduce swelling, and ease pain following acute or chronic musculoskeletal injury.

The name Zheng Gu Shui translates to “Bone-Setting Water,” reflecting its traditional role in traumatology to support recovery from sprains, contusions, bruising, tendon injuries, and post-traumatic swelling. When applied to the affected area, the herbal alcohol base allows the ingredients to penetrate quickly, helping disperse blood stasis and promote healthy circulation in injured tissues.

This topical preparation is intended for external use only and is commonly used to support recovery from:

  • sprains and strains
  • bruising and contusions
  • tendon or ligament injuries
  • joint pain and swelling
  • post-traumatic stiffness

Zheng Gu Shui has been widely used in Chinese medicine clinics and martial arts settings for generations as a convenient and fast-absorbing liniment for musculoskeletal support.

Ingredients

20% active ingredients from TCM herbal infusion with grain alcohol:
dang gui, xu duan, gu sui bu, chuan xiong, san qi, ru xiang, mo yao, hong hua

0.5% active ingredients:
menthol, witch hazel, vegetable glycerin, aloe vera liquid, distilled water

External use only. Do not apply to open wounds or irritated skin.
